71.5 dB, louder than the 2020 he tested. When I drove the refresh LS500 I saw no improvement in noise, there is an improvement in ride. Its just not luxury car quiet inside.

70 dB. So according to Alex the Pacifica is quieter than the LS500. He tests at a lower speed than I do, and wind noise sets into the Pacifica about 70 MPH so that explains why I measured the LS500 as being 1dB quieter.

But no, the LS500 is nowhere near as quiet as an LS460, S Class, 7 Series, A8 etc. He measured 68 dB for the S560, 68.5 for the S580, 68.5 for the G90, 68.5 for the 7 Series, 69 for a GLS, etc
in the video at the point you mentioned, he says it's a) likely the tires, b) it's noticeable on bad roads, c) on good roads it's just as quiet as other flagships, d) i suspect it was a deliberate decision by lexus to not make this a total cocoon. the ls500 is clearly meant to 'seem' sportier than previous LS's even if it's not really that sporty. (edit: i now see this is a video for the ls500h not the ls500)

similarly, i was surprised my lc500 lets as much road noise into the cabin as it does. again, it's not bad on good roads when cruising, but the run flats are definitely noisy on bad surfaces and the LC doesn't have double-pane side glass.

Did you miss where I also said replacing the tires would help? The road surface where I test sound pressure is pretty smooth, and I measured 1dB less than my Pacifica, still nowhere near as quiet as the other flagships or the LS460.

I suspect also it was Lexus' decision to do this, like most of their other decisions when designing that car I think it was a mistake and it lost them my business and many other people's business.

similarly, i was surprised my lc500 lets as much road noise into the cabin as it does
Lexus has never been good at insulating from road noise. Thats the primary difference between my S560 and LS460L, Mercedes is much better at that. Thats why I have always been so careful to choose the right tires for a Lexus and to replace the tires when its new. After replacing the tires on the S560 when it was new, I probably wouldn't do that again because it didnt make any difference. On the right tires a Lexus is as quiet as you will find. The wrong tires have you thinking something is wrong with it.

Saw the new G90 today. Doesn’t have the presence of the Germans. (Nowhere close). To me, it looks like Hyundai benchmarked the Lexus LS500 which makes the G90 look 5-6 years old in design. I look at the interior, the screens look fantastic but the HVAC lacks modern styling. Also the interior door panels do not look modern and contemporary with the large piece of wood on the door. For some reason, there is a hideous 4WD badge or it is supposed to be Awd on the rear that reminded me of badging from the 1980s






Also, the door handles were all stuck in the open position (or is it supposed to be that way)
